蓝屏虚拟机dnf关游戏:解决方案全攻略

2025-09-30 23:38:48 游戏资讯 lvseyouxi

很多玩家在用虚拟机玩DNF(地下城与勇士)时,遇到“蓝屏”现象,尤其是在退出游戏、切换桌面、或者游戏负载峰值阶段,屏幕直接变成冰蓝色,系统崩溃重启。这类问题往往不是单点原因,而是硬件、驱动、虚拟化设置以及游戏本身多方因素叠加的结果。先别慌,整理思路、按步骤排查,一条条把坑踩死,蓝屏就会变成传说中的“已经过去了”的活动记录。

先来把常见表现和错误代码拉清单。BSOD(Blue Screen of Death)在虚拟机里出现时,屏幕会伴随一个错误代码,如 IRQL_NOT_LESS_OR_EQUAL、PAGE_FAULT_IN_NONPAGED_AREA、VIDEO_TDR_FAILURE、DRIVER_POWER_STATE_FAILURE、KMODE_EXCEPTION_NOT_HANDLED 等等。不同代码对应的原因会有侧重:有时是显卡驱动或虚拟化显卡驱动的问题,有时是内存或内核驱动之间的冲突,也有可能是宿主机与来宾机之间的资源竞争。理解这些代码并不等于立刻修复,但可以帮助你把诊断方向往正确的路上推。

在虚拟机生态里,常用的主流环境包括 VirtualBox、VMware Workstation/Player、Hyper-V 等。它们的设置逻辑类似:给来宾系统分配足够的内存与显存、是否开启3D加速、是否安装并更新来宾增强工具、以及宿主机的显卡驱动状态。不同平台有各自的坑点:有的在开启3D加速后稳定性会下降,有的需要特定版本的来宾扩展工具;有的则对宿主机显卡驱动的新旧敏感度高。把不同平台的要点分开讲,有助于你快速定位问题根源。

先说 VirtualBox 的要点。确保安装了最新的 VirtualBox 版本以及来宾扩展包。来宾系统的显卡设置尽量使用 SVGA 3D 模式,若出现不稳定,尝试切换到 VBoxVGA/VBoxSVGA 的不同组合,同时关闭或降低 3D 加速。分配给来宾的内存不宜过高,通常给 2GB 到 4GB(视系统版本与宿主机内存总量而定)较为稳妥;显存建议分配到 128MB~256MB,超过可能引发驱动兼容问题。此外,检查宿主机禁用的超线程、CPU 限制、以及电源计划,避免系统在高负载时进入节电模式导致时序错乱。

如果你在 VMware 环境下遇到同样问题,重点是确保安装最新的 VMware Tools(来宾工具),并尝试不同的图形设置组合,例如启用或禁用 3D 显示。VMware 对显卡直通和宿主机显卡并行的处理较为稳健,但有时也会因为来宾驱动版本和主机驱动版本的冲突出现蓝屏。分配内存时,确保不会让来宾系统抢走宿主机的全部资源,尤其是当宿主机还在跑浏览器、编辑器等应用时,要留出缓冲。

在 Hyper-V 场景下,蓝屏的成因往往和虚拟化平台的集成服务、显卡重定向,以及内存回收策略有关。Hyper-V 的“增强会话模式”和“虚拟机消费内存”策略会影响到游戏对显存和系统内存的请求。尝试开启或关闭“离线映像”的某些选项,调整内存分配到来宾机的合适区间(如 4096MB 左右,具体看主机总内存),再结合打开/关闭“见证者驱动程序”的选项,看看问题是否缓解。

来宾系统与主机之间的工具与驱动更新也至关重要。来宾操作系统若长期未打补丁,或者虚拟机工具版本落后,可能在游戏加载或关机阶段触发驱动栈的异常。确保来宾系统的显卡驱动、DirectX/OpenGL 版本都与游戏版本匹配;同时更新宿主机的显卡驱动到最新稳定版,并尽量保持与虚拟化软件版本相匹配的驱动组合。驱动不和谐是造成蓝屏的高发原因之一。

资源配置方面,内存和显存的稳健分配是关键。DNF 属于大型 *** 游戏,对显卡渲染和内存带宽要求较高。给来宾机分配足够的内存、合理的显存,以及充足的 CPU 核心数,能显著降低崩溃概率。若宿主机内存紧张,考虑用页面文件和内存压缩的策略进行缓冲,但这通常会带来额外的性能开销与稳定性折中,需权衡后再决定。

蓝屏虚拟机dnf关游戏

图形与驱动的兼容性也是重要环节。启用 3D 加速有时会提供更好的渲染表现,但在某些配置下会引发驱动冲突,从而诱发蓝屏。尝试在来宾机里将游戏分辨率降至中等或低端设置,关闭高分辨率纹理和抗锯齿等高耗参数,看看是否能够减轻驱动栈的压力。这些调整能帮助你确认问题是因性能压力导致,还是驱动层面的冲突造成。

系统层面的调试也不容忽视。若蓝屏发生时能进入到 Windows 的错误信息界面,可以记录停止代码、文件名以及相关模块。随后在事件查看器中查找“系统”和“应用程序”日志,结合内存转储文件(如果系统设置为自动生成转储文件)进行分析。你也可以使用蓝屏查看工具(如 BlueScreenView)快速定位崩溃时引用的驱动模块或核心组件,帮助快速定位到底是哪个驱动在作崇。

在调试过程中,开启来宾机的错误转储功能非常有用。将系统设置为在蓝屏发生时生成小型转储文件(Minidump),并把转储文件传输到宿主机进行分析。若你具备一定的调试能力,可以借助 WinDbg 等工具对转储文件进行符号化和分析,定位是哪个驱动在崩溃时触发中断。这类 *** 对解决复杂冲突往往比盲走鼠洞更高效。

此外,清晰的操作步骤自会让问题解决更具可控性。先从基础做起:更新虚拟机软件、更新来宾扩展工具、更新宿主机显卡驱动、更新来宾系统补丁;再评估资源分配是否合理,调整内存、显存、CPU 核心数的分布;接着尝试关闭或开启图形加速选项、调整游戏画质设置;若问题仍旧,开启错误转储并用工具分析,最后再考虑替换虚拟化平台或在物理机上测试以排除虚拟化因素。上述过程像做一道多层次的菜,逐层确认口味是否合适。

广告时间到,这里有一个小彩蛋:玩游戏想要赚零花钱就上七评赏金榜,网站地址:bbs.77.ink。若你在玩游戏时还想要一个社区共同体来分享攻略、修复心得和灵感,这样的小站也许正是你需要的那一口气。

最后,若你已经尝试了上述 *** 仍未解决问题,可以考虑两条备选路。之一条是换用另一台虚拟机环境,或在物理机上重新安装并测试同样的游戏,看看是否硬件层面的冲突依旧存在。第二条是利用云端或远程桌面方案来运行DNF,避免本地虚拟化带来的复杂驱动栈问题。路走到这里,问题仍未揭晓,或许就像解一道脑筋急转弯:当蓝屏降临时,驱动、系统、硬件三方谁在按下暂停键?你愿意继续追问下去,还是先把这台虚拟机放回待命?